What Is the Value of Auditor Training?

Auditors rely heavily on their knowledge, skills, and expertise when performing audits. A fact which makes auditor training an invaluable measure to continuously ensure a compliant, safe, and efficient operation.
Auditor

Continuous learning is the minimum requirement for success in any field.

In aviation, auditor training is no different. A well-trained auditor is uniquely qualified to identify potential hazards, assess risks, and support a culture of continuous improvement.

There are, of course, some mandatory requirements for auditor training. This includes requirements from ISO and ICAO – as well as training requirements from various national aviation authorities.

Still, many organisations fail to prioritise proper training of their auditors.

Training Is Key

Auditor training fosters qualified and capable auditors who can conduct thorough and valuable auditsEssentially, training contributes to safer and more efficient operations.



In addition, auditor training generates several valuable benefits. For instance, a well-trained auditor will reflect an enhanced understanding of the roles and responsibilities of an auditor. Moreover, an auditor who has received good training will develop better skills in identifying, managing, and reporting risks according to best practice. This contributes to streamlining operations and reducing costs.
